引言
在数据驱动的时代,数据可视化变得越来越重要。通过GitHub平台,开发者可以实现大屏可视化效果,使得项目展示更加直观与吸引人。本文将探讨GitHub大屏可视化的基本概念、相关工具以及具体实现方法。
GitHub大屏可视化的基本概念
大屏可视化指的是在大屏幕上以视觉化的方式展示数据和信息。使用GitHub进行大屏可视化,可以为团队成员和项目利益相关者提供清晰的数据展示,进而提升团队的沟通效率。
大屏可视化的意义
- 提升信息传递效率:以图形化的方式展示数据,易于理解。
- 增强数据的互动性:使用动态可视化,可以与数据进行互动,发现潜在信息。
- 提高团队协作:为团队提供统一的视图,促进沟通与协作。
相关工具与技术
在实现GitHub大屏可视化的过程中,以下工具和技术是不可或缺的:
1. 数据可视化库
- D3.js:强大的数据驱动文档库,可以创建动态、交互式的可视化。
- Chart.js:简单易用的图表库,适合快速开发和展示数据。
- ECharts:百度推出的可视化库,功能强大且灵活。
2. 开发工具
- Node.js:可用于构建服务器端应用,支持实时数据更新。
- Vue.js:前端框架,可以快速构建用户界面。
- Express:简化的Web应用框架,适用于构建API和Web服务。
GitHub大屏可视化的实现步骤
在进行大屏可视化之前,需要遵循一些基本步骤:
步骤1:准备数据
首先,您需要确定展示的数据来源。可以使用以下几种方式获取数据:
- 从数据库获取实时数据。
- 使用API接口获取外部数据。
- 直接从GitHub项目中提取数据。
步骤2:选择可视化库
根据数据类型和展示需求,选择合适的可视化库。
- 如果需要复杂的可视化,推荐使用D3.js。
- 对于简单的图表展示,Chart.js或ECharts会更合适。
步骤3:搭建项目
使用Node.js和Express创建一个简单的Web服务器,将前端与后端进行连接。
步骤4:实现前端可视化
使用选定的可视化库,将数据渲染到网页上,创建动态交互的界面。
步骤5:部署项目
将项目部署到GitHub Pages或其他Web服务器上,方便团队访问。
实例分析
以一个示例项目为基础,展示如何实现GitHub大屏可视化:
示例项目概述
本项目使用GitHub API获取开源项目的数据,通过D3.js进行可视化展示。
代码实现
- 获取数据:通过GitHub API获取特定项目的Issue数量和状态。
- 数据处理:将获取的数据进行格式化处理。
- 可视化展示:使用D3.js创建动态图表,展示每个Issue的状态。
常见问题解答(FAQ)
GitHub大屏可视化如何实现?
实现GitHub大屏可视化主要分为数据准备、选择可视化库、搭建项目、实现前端可视化和部署项目等步骤。
有哪些工具可以用于GitHub大屏可视化?
可以使用D3.js、Chart.js、ECharts等数据可视化库,以及Node.js、Vue.js等开发工具。
如何选择合适的数据可视化库?
选择数据可视化库应根据数据的复杂程度、交互需求以及项目的技术栈来决定。
GitHub大屏可视化适合哪些场景?
适合用于团队协作、项目展示、数据监控等场景。
结论
通过GitHub大屏可视化,开发者不仅可以提升信息传递效率,还能增强数据的互动性和提高团队协作。借助合适的工具与方法,可以轻松实现数据的动态展示,助力团队的成功。